Могу ли я запросить экземпляр Grok ZODB за пределами области веб-приложения?

У меня есть веб-приложение на основе grok, которое сохраняет данные с помощью ZODB. Могу ли я запросить базу данных объекта в автономном режиме, то есть из скрипта Python, который будет запускаться на веб-сервере, на котором размещается экземпляр веб-приложения grok/paste?

И будут ли какие-либо проблемы при этом, когда веб-сервер одновременно взаимодействует с базой данных?


person rutherford    schedule 02.01.2012    source источник


Ответы (1)


Вы можете открыть ZODB с помощью python и проверить данные, да. Для этого при одновременном запуске веб-сайта вам потребуется использовать слой параллелизма, такой как ZEO или RelStorage; в противном случае обычный FileStorage не поддерживает одновременный доступ.

person Martijn Pieters    schedule 02.01.2012